About UBX UBX Training is a fast-growing fitness business co-founded by four-time world boxing champion, Danny Green, alongside Australian fitness and tech entrepreneur, Tim West. We first opened in Australia in 2016 and have since expanded rapidly, enjoying five years of continuous growth, with 100 clubs now open across Australia, New Zealand, Japan and Singapore. We launched in the UK in 2022! At UBX, we deliver a sense of community, camaraderie and belonging, the most attractive aspects of sports, and combine these elements with convenience, accessibility, expert support, and intelligent programming. We have identified the reasons that motivate an individual to take control of their fitness and the barriers that may stop them, to create an environment where results are an additional benefit to the pure enjoyment of the workout. UBX’s unique boxing and strength training is non-contact and focuses on a mixture of bag work, padwork and strength training across a 12-round workout. In every workout, our members get 1 on 1 support from a UBX coach who advises on form and technique and ensures that the experience can work for people of all ages, backgrounds, and fitness levels. We deliver the most convenient, enjoyable, and effective workout to our members as well as a rewarding and enjoyable business for franchisees.
